P028 NEW FILTER FOR CALCULATION OF CURRENT DENSITY PSEUDOSECTIONS FROM VLF DIP ANGLE DATA Abstract 1 VLF is one of popular electromagnetic prospecting techniques. In spite of easy data acquisition it’s data interpretation is complicated and there is not a certain method for it. Current density pseudosections that can be calculated by raw data filtering are good tools for preliminary interpretation. In this research we proposed a new approach for obtaining them.
